Late in 65 were these a factory option? I am working on a C code March 65 build date car that has a factory GT headlamp harness in it. So maybe it was replaced or could have ford ran out of harnesses and installed a GT one? Core support has been changed so there are no holes for the wires

There are two special harnesses used in 1965 for fog lamps, the under dash and the under hood. Fog lamps were included in the GT package and in the deluxe interior package. Both packages had a 66 type 5 dial instrument cluster. The deluxe interior would have a "B" after the body type on the door data plate, 63B, 65B and 76B. Check the instrument cluster first.

You are both absolutely correct, the 1965 five dial underdash wiring harness included fog light wiring although it was not used.
